![]() 1691 Thursday, 27 March, 2025, 12:57 F1 legend Schumacher - who won seven world championships - was involved in the incident in December 2013 that left him in a medically induced coma. He hasn't appeared publicly since. Felix Gorner, a reporter for German broadcaster RTL, has lifted the lid to fans on Schumacher's status and revealed he "can no longer communicate verbally". "The situation is very sad," said Gorner, who is viewed as one of the journalists closest to Schumacher's family and a reliable source on his health. In 2013, after finishing his professional career, Schumacher suffered a severe head injury while skiing in the French Alps. For a long time, he was bedridden and connected to a ventilator. The ex-racer's family carefully protects his private life, not disclosing details about his current condition. Schumacher is 56 years old, he is a seven-time Formula 1 world champion and is considered one of the best racers in the history of this championship. |
